The faculty-to-student ratio at KCET, Amritsar is approximately 1:20, which allows for good peronal interaction between teachers and students The course structure follows the university guidelines and is well- designed, covering both theoretical and practical aspects. Each semester includes two sessioal exams, assignment, oracticalevaluations, and a final university exam. The marking scheme usually consist of 40% internal marks and 60% external marks.
I am currently pursuing a B.Tech degree at KCET, Amritsar 1st Year: Rs 150000 (Including tution fees, admission fess, registration fess, lab fees, hostle and mess charges) 2nd year: Rs 125000 3rd Year: 125000 4th Year: 125000 The total fee for the complete four year B.Tech course is approximately Rs 525000.

The course curriculum at PCCOE follows the Savitribai Phule Pune University (SPPU) guidelines, and it is quite structured and well-balanced. I chose this course mainly because it includes both core theoretical concepts and hands-on practical learning, especially through labs, mini-projects, and industry-oriented workshops. The curriculum gives a strong foundation in engineering fundamentals and also helps in developing technical, analytical, and communication skills which are useful for both placements and higher studies. The college regularly conducts value-added courses, industrial visits, and guest lectures to bridge the gap between academics and real-world applications. PCCOE places a lot of focus on project-based learning. From the second year onwards, students work on small projects and by the final year, they complete a full major project often guided by industry mentors. This helps in applying theoretical knowledge to practical use cases — very helpful for placements and research. Also, a few subjects are slightly outdated because of the university’s fixed structure, though teachers do their best to make them relevant with extra content. We get alot of time for exams preparation as there is no mid term
The faculty members at PCCOE are quite knowledgeable and experienced, especially in the ENTC, Computer, and IT departments. Most professors hold M.Tech or Ph.D. degrees, and they emphasize both theoretical and practical learning. They regularly guide students for projects, research papers, and competitions. The faculty-to-student ratio is around 1:20, which allows good individual attention. Teachers are generally approachable and supportive — you can easily reach them for academic doubts, mentorship, or even personal guidance. Many professors also help students with mini-projects, hackathons, and placement preparation.
